Output d528caf1422656e7c81051eac9eda6de0b1a36605d3e1f4512ac049ec7fd9060:58

value
1069989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a0689cc429e318fcd0d5161f033cd5e8232c065 OP_EQUALVERIFY OP_CHECKSIG
address
1Po1mFCS9HLVHy9GJWgByDUjb4YDXePYpd
transaction
d528caf1422656e7c81051eac9eda6de0b1a36605d3e1f4512ac049ec7fd9060
confirmations
265835
spent
true